US 7,481,374 B2
System and method for placement and retrieval of embedded information within a document
John O. Walker, Rochester, N.Y. (US); and James W. Reid, Fairport, N.Y. (US)
Assigned to Xerox Corporation, Norwalk, Conn. (US)
Filed on Jun. 08, 2005, as Appl. No. 11/148,130.
Prior Publication US 2006/0278724 A1, Dec. 14, 2006
Int. Cl. G06K 19/06 (2006.01)
U.S. Cl. 235—494  [235/487] 20 Claims
OG exemplary drawing
 
1. A system for placing at least one embedded data block on a document, the system comprising:
a layout analyzer for determining at least one whitespace area within a document, each of the at least one whitespace area being suitable to place a respective embedded data block image,
the layout analyzer further determining an ordered plurality of locations within the at least one whitespace area to receive an ordered plurality of embedded data block images;
an embedded data block creator for encoding information into the ordered plurality of embedded data block images, the embedded data block creator further encoding, into the ordered plurality of embedded data block images, a specification of the ordered plurality of locations; and
a writer for writing the ordered plurality of embedded data block images into the at least one whitespace area in accordance with the ordered plurality of locations.